What to do in Bisbee, Arizona, United States of America
Bisbee, located in the southeastern region of Arizona, is a unique and charming town with a rich, colorful history. Known for its mining heritage, Bisbee is now a popular tourist destination that offers visitors a glimpse into its past while enjoying its present-day attractions. Here are some of the top tourist attractions in Bisbee, Arizona.
1. Bisbee Mining and Historical Museum
The Bisbee Mining and Historical Museum is a fascinating attraction that explores the town's rich mining history. The museum features exhibits that tell the story of the town, its people, and its mining operations. It has an extensive collection of artifacts, mining equipment, photographs, and documents that reflect the town's rich mining heritage.
2. Lavender Pit
The Lavender Pit is an old open-pit copper mine located in the heart of Bisbee. It was once one of the largest copper mines in the United States and is now an impressive sightseeing destination. Visitors can take a self-guided tour of the pit to get a feel for what it was like to work in a copper mine.
3. Old Bisbee Ghost Tour
The Old Bisbee Ghost Tour is a guided walking tour that takes visitors on a spooky journey through the town's haunted history. The tour visits paranormal hotspots such as the Copper Queen Hotel, the Bisbee Community Center, and the Oliver House, among others. The tour is a great way to explore Bisbee's dark and mysterious past.
4. Arizona Copper Queen Mine Tour
The Arizona Copper Queen Mine Tour is a popular attraction that offers visitors an opportunity to experience an underground copper mine. The tour guides visitors through the tunnels of the Queen Mine, explaining the history of copper mining and the methods used to extract it. Visitors get to wear hard hats and carry mining lamps as they traverse through the mine's depths.
5. Bisbee's Brewery Gulch
Bisbee's Brewery Gulch is a must-see attraction for any visitor to Bisbee. Once a notorious red-light district, Brewery Gulch is now home to a collection of eclectic shops, art galleries, and restaurants. The area's historic buildings and colorful murals make it an ideal place to stroll and explore.
6. Bisbee Art Museum
The Bisbee Art Museum is a beautifully restored historic building that showcases local and regional art. The museum features a varied collection of artwork, including paintings, ceramics, sculpture, and photographs. Visitors can wander through the galleries to appreciate the art or attend one of the museum's lectures or events.
7. Bisbee Farmers Market
The Bisbee Farmers Market is a vibrant and bustling marketplace where visitors can shop for fresh produce, artisanal goods, and handmade crafts. The market is open on Saturdays and features a diverse range of vendors selling everything from homemade jams to organic vegetables.
